-
- composer的--no-scripts参数是什么作用_Composer --no-scripts参数作用说明
- 使用--no-scripts参数可跳过Composer安装或更新时的脚本执行,如post-install-cmd、post-autoload-dump等,适用于避免自动操作干扰、调试脚本错误或在CI/CD中分阶段处理任务,提升流程控制精度。
- composer . 开发工具 931 2025-10-13 09:18:02
-
- Composer install和update有什么核心区别?
- composerinstall按照composer.lock文件安装依赖,确保环境一致;若无lock文件则根据composer.json安装并生成lock文件,适用于部署和团队协作。composerupdate忽略lock文件,依据composer.json将依赖升级到符合约束的最新版本,用于开发阶段获取新功能或安全补丁。关键区别:install保证稳定复现,update主动升级依赖。生产环境应使用install避免意外变更,开发时按需运行update更新指定包。简言之:install是“照着清
- composer . 开发工具 344 2025-10-13 09:15:02
-
- sublime怎么恢复默认设置_Sublime Text还原到初始出厂设置方法
- 关闭SublimeText并确保进程已结束,2.删除系统中对应的Data配置文件夹,3.重新启动SublimeText即可恢复默认设置,所有自定义配置和插件将被清除。
- sublime . 开发工具 313 2025-10-13 09:13:01
-
- composer的"vendor-dir"和"bin-dir"配置有什么区别
- vendor-dir用于指定依赖包的安装目录,默认为vendor,可自定义如libs/vendor;bin-dir用于存放可执行文件的链接或副本,默认为vendor/bin,可改为scripts等目录。两者均在composer.json的config中配置,修改后需重新运行composerinstall或update生效,分别影响类库存储位置和命令行工具访问路径。
- composer . 开发工具 741 2025-10-13 09:00:01
-
- VSCode 的扩展更新策略是自动还是手动,如何控制以避免意外?
- VSCode扩展默认自动更新,但可手动控制以平衡便利与稳定性。用户可通过设置"extensions.autoUpdate"选择自动或禁用更新,并利用@outdated筛选待更新扩展。对关键扩展建议禁用自动更新以避免兼容性问题,同时定期手动检查更新日志,确保安全与功能同步。若更新引发问题,可回滚至历史版本或使用“ExtensionBisect”排查冲突,结合输出面板和开发者工具定位错误,实现高效问题解决。
- VSCode . 开发工具 795 2025-10-13 08:48:02
-
- sublime怎么把选中的文本转换为大写或小写_sublime大小写快速转换操作技巧
- 选中文本转大写可使用快捷键Ctrl+K再按Ctrl+U,转小写则按Ctrl+L,首字母大写用Ctrl+K加Ctrl+C,Mac用户将Ctrl替换为Cmd,还可通过插件扩展更多格式转换功能。
- sublime . 开发工具 384 2025-10-13 08:48:01
-
- Composer的--working-dir(-d)参数在自动化脚本中如何使用?
- 使用--working-dir参数可在不切换路径的情况下指定Composer操作目录,适用于批量处理项目、CI/CD流水线和部署脚本,提升自动化效率与可靠性。
- composer . 开发工具 334 2025-10-13 08:45:01
-
- 如何强制Composer重新安装所有依赖包?
- 先删除vendor目录和composer.lock文件,再清除缓存并重新安装。具体步骤为:执行rm-rfvendor和rmcomposer.lock删除旧文件;运行composerclear-cache清除本地缓存;最后使用composerinstall重新安装所有依赖,可选--no-dev和--optimize-autoloader参数优化安装结果。
- composer . 开发工具 417 2025-10-13 08:40:01
-
- composer如何处理PHP扩展依赖
- Composer能自动检测PHP扩展依赖,只需在composer.json中用ext-前缀声明require扩展,如ext-json、ext-pdo和ext-gd,并指定版本;运行composerinstall时会检查环境是否满足,缺失则报错提示;可选扩展可通过suggest字段推荐安装;实际部署时需通过php.ini、包管理器或Dockerfile确保扩展启用,Composer虽不安装扩展但能精准定位缺失项,提升协作效率。
- composer . 开发工具 573 2025-10-13 08:34:01
-
- 如何在Laravel项目中使用Composer管理依赖?
- Composer是Laravel项目依赖管理核心工具,通过composer.json配置require、require-dev和autoload字段;使用composerinstall安装依赖,composerrequire添加新包,composerupdate更新包;生产环境建议用composerinstall--optimize-autoloader--no-dev优化性能。
- composer . 开发工具 936 2025-10-13 08:26:01
-
- 如何在composer.json中定义项目的元数据(如作者、许可证)?
- 在composer.json中定义元数据需使用JSON格式,authors字段以数组形式列出作者信息,每个作者包含name、email和可选homepage;license字段声明许可证类型,支持单个或多个许可证;description为必填项,keywords、homepage和支持链接等字段有助于提升项目可发现性与协作效率。
- composer . 开发工具 554 2025-10-13 08:23:01
-
- sublime怎么将界面语言切换回英文_sublime从中文切回英文界面的步骤
- 切换回英文界面需修改Localizations.sublime-settings文件中的语言代码为en_US并重启软件。具体步骤:1.进入用户配置目录User;2.编辑Localizations.sublime-settings,将"zh_CN"改为"en_US"或清空内容;3.保存后重启SublimeText;4.可选删除中文包彻底恢复。
- sublime . 开发工具 246 2025-10-13 08:20:01
-
- VSCode的终端怎么分屏?
- VSCode终端分屏可通过快捷键或右键菜单实现:使用Ctrl+\(Windows/Linux)或Cmd+\(Mac)可垂直拆分终端;也可在终端面板右键选择“拆分终端”进行分屏操作。
- VSCode . 开发工具 1103 2025-10-12 23:58:01
-
- 如何配置VSCode以获得流畅的React开发体验?
- 安装ESLint、Prettier、AutoRenameTag等插件提升效率;2.配置settings.json实现保存时自动格式化与修复;3.创建rfc、useEffect等代码片段加速开发;4.使用内置终端运行npmstart,结合DebuggerforChrome调试。合理设置可使VSCode成为高效React开发工具。
- VSCode . 开发工具 976 2025-10-12 23:45:02
-
- 如何修改VSCode的JSON配置文件时的智能提示?
- 通过关联JSONSchema可提升VSCode中JSON文件的智能提示。1.在JSON文件顶部添加$schema字段指向Schema地址,如"http://json.schemastore.org/tsconfig",即可获得对应配置的自动补全和错误检查;2.通过用户设置中的"json.schemas"配置项,按fileMatch路径模式全局绑定Schema,避免每个文件手动添加;3.支持引用本地Schema文件,适用于私有或离线场景,提升定制化JSON格
- VSCode . 开发工具 336 2025-10-12 23:36:01
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

